So bad that the ships were initially limited to 26.5 knots and this was never really fully cured. While the American powerplant was much more efficient and granted a much longer cruising range when run up to full power there was a very bad longitudinal vibration. Maneuverable but with only middling speed – her turning circle was well within that of a King George V class ship but top speed was slower than the British ships under normal circumstance.Decent staying power – her armor was likely the least of the various ~35,000 tone treaty battleships and she definitely lacked armored freeboard.impressive heavy anti-aircraft capability – the 5”/38 was the best heavy AA gun of the war and she carried 20.unmatched gun power – her nine 16”/45 were the most powerful gun battery in the world for about 7 months then Yamato was competed. The gun size limited lapsed/escalated to 16” while the ships were being designed so instead of the planned twelve 14” gun there were nine brand new 16”45’s with the new 2700# shell. There were dozens of designs, 8, 9, and 12 guns, thicker armor, thinner armor, faster, slower, all the guns before the bridge like Nelson, two turrets bow and one aft, two ahead and two aft, the ship is almost a monument to compromises.
